News Wrap: FBI investigating the Clinton Foundation

Did the Clintons promise any political favors in exchange for charitable contributions?

The FBI is reportedly investigating whether the Clintons promised or delivered any political favors in exchange for charitable contributions to the Clinton Foundation. Also: Bitter cold continues to numb the East Coast, with at least seven people dying in weather-related incidents.
